Question
State whether the following statements are True or False. Give reasons in support of your answer:
(i) When the population distribution is unknown and the data are measured on a nominal scale, the Sign test can be used to test a hypothesis about the median.
(ii) In the Bayesian framework, prior information about the parameter is combined with the likelihood to obtain the posterior distribution.
(iii) The Wilcoxon rank-sum test is a non-parametric alternative to the two-sample t-test when normality is not assumed.
(iv) A complete sufficient statistic guarantees the uniqueness of the unbiased estimator obtained through it.
(v) The power of a statistical test is the probability of accepting the null hypothesis when it is true.
Answer :
Word Count : 301
(i) False. The Sign test is a non-parametric test used to make inferences about the median, but it requires at least ordinal data so that observations can be meaningfully compared as being above or below the hypothesized median. Nominal scale data lack any inherent ordering, so it is not possible to determine signs relative to a median. Therefore, the Sign test cannot be appropriately applied when data are purely nominal.
